Jonah Hill will no longer promote his films to “protect” his mental health

This content was published on Aug 18, 2022 – 01:27

Los Angeles (USA), August 17 (EFE). Actor Jonah Hill (“Django Unchained” or “Don’t Look Up”) has decided not to participate in promoting audiovisual projects he is involved in in order to “protect” your mental health.

Hill will not attend public events or appear in the media to promote his new products because these situations “aggravate” his “anxiety attacks,” the translator explains in the content of a letter published by specialist media Deadline on Wednesday.

You won’t see me promoting this movie, or any of my upcoming movies, because I’m taking this important step to protect myself.

The protagonist of “Super Cool” has explained that he has had this condition for nearly 20 years and that acting in front of an audience only exacerbates his anxiety and stress issues.

The actor’s writing came to light when he just finished “Stutz,” a documentary starring and directed by himself that still doesn’t have a specific release date but will see the light of day soon.

In this work, the focus is on Hill’s own mental health and how he is trying to improve with the help of his psychiatrist. In addition, the weight of pressure experienced by familiar faces in the film industry and how it affects them personally is analyzed.

All this is a “journey of self-discovery” that the translator will provide to the audience so that it “serves as therapy and provides tools for a wide audience”, thus trying to prevent them from going through the same situation.

Despite his mental health issues, at the age of 38, the Los Angeles actor was motivated by the future of his career on the big screen and stated that he wouldn’t stop working “while battling anxiety”. EFE
